Position Overview: 
The Warehouse Lead is responsible for the successful execution of the VAS line assignments and projects. Establishes an effective work team by reviewing goals, and training, and provides ongoing development to the operators.
Shift:   Monday - Friday (2:30 PM - 11:00PM

Position Responsibilities:
 
  • Provides project/line assignments works supervisory station, and backfills for warehouse LMI.
  • Balance workloads between project lines and shift resources as needed.
  • Develop and directs a plan of action for the shift.
  • Reviews overall manpower schedules to assure that the shipping and receiving operations are scheduled in the most efficient and effective fashion.
  • Tours warehouse area on a regular basis to assist in location inventory, answer questions, solve problems, facilitate hot order handling, and locate and eliminate sources of damage.
  • Establishes priorities, makes key decisions on inventory rotation, manpower, and equipment utilization, and corrects paperwork errors.
  • Moving, locating, relocating, stacking, and counting products, operating material handling equipment (slip-sheet attachments, clamp attachments, pallet jacks, or other power equipment)
  • Perform manual lifting of products to fill orders and verify freight quantities.
  • Maintain company standards for safety, security, and productivity.
